1. Planning
Planning is a crucial step in starting any business, and the travel and tours industry is no exception. A well-developed business plan will serve as a roadmap for your business, outlining your goals, strategies, and financial projections. It will also help you to identify your target market and choose the right services to offer.
Your target market is the group of people who are most likely to be interested in your tours and travel services. It is important to understand your target market’s demographics, interests, and needs so that you can tailor your marketing and sales efforts accordingly. For example, if you are targeting families, you may want to offer tours that are geared towards children and that include activities that the whole family can enjoy.
Once you have identified your target market, you need to choose the right services to offer. This will depend on your target market’s interests and needs, as well as your own expertise and experience. For example, if you are targeting adventure travelers, you may want to offer tours that include hiking, biking, and kayaking. If you are targeting luxury travelers, you may want to offer tours that include high-end accommodations and dining experiences.
By carefully planning your business, you can increase your chances of success in the travel and tours industry. A well-developed business plan will help you to identify your target market, choose the right services to offer, and set realistic financial goals.

3. Operations
Operations are the backbone of any business, and the travel and tours industry is no exception. Managing the day-to-day operations of your business efficiently and effectively is crucial to your success. This includes booking tours, managing finances, and providing excellent customer service.
Booking tours involves working with suppliers to secure the best rates and availability for your customers. You will also need to manage customer payments and reservations, as well as provide pre-departure information and support. Managing finances is also a critical aspect of running a travel and tours business. This includes tracking income and expenses, preparing financial reports, and managing cash flow. You will also need to be aware of the tax implications of your business and comply with all applicable laws and regulations.
Providing excellent customer service is essential for building a strong reputation and repeat business. This means being responsive to customer inquiries, resolving complaints promptly, and going the extra mile to ensure that your customers have a positive experience. By providing excellent customer service, you can build trust and loyalty with your customers, which will lead to increased bookings and revenue.
